To find a lost Bitcoin address, search through old records, email accounts, or devices where you may have stored the address. If the address was used with a particular wallet, such as a software wallet or web wallet, you might be able to recover it through the password recovery process or by accessing old backups. In cases where the address is tied to a lost Bitcoin wallet, brute force or specialized tools might be necessary, though success isn’t guaranteed. The mortality of Bitcoin owners introduces a unique challenge to the digital asset world. Without proper estate planning that includes the transfer of private key information, a deceased person’s Bitcoin wallet can become permanently inaccessible. This scenario highlights the importance of including digital assets in one’s estate planning.

Private keys are the cornerstone of accessing Bitcoin wallets. They are unique strings of characters that unlock the ability to access and manage one’s digital assets. Losing these keys is like losing the combination to a safe; without them, the wallet’s contents become unreachable. This loss can occur through simple forgetfulness, hardware failure, or data corruption.

Finding a lost Bitcoin account involves retracing your steps to locate where you stored your private keys or seed phrases. This could be within hardware wallets, software wallets, or mobile wallets that you previously used.

For example, the popular Bitcoin wallet Electrum uses a standard seed phrase of 12 words, while other wallets like Trezor use a 24-word seed phrase. In order to access your crypto funds, you will need to enter your seed phrase in your wallet. Keeping your seed phrase safe and secure is crucial as it is the only way to recover your money if you lose your wallet or forget your password. To recover a Bitcoin paper wallet, you must import its private key into a software wallet, mobile wallet, or hardware wallet. This process requires scanning the QR code or manually entering the private key into a particular wallet. Once imported, you can access and transfer your Bitcoin from the paper wallet. Always ensure you follow the password recovery process and securely store your private key to avoid lost assets.
